AI Item Analysis

This sculptural piece depicts a sleek, stalking panther rendered in a dark-toned metallic medium, likely cast bronze with a rich, mottled brown and green patina that suggests age and handling. The feline is captured in a dynamic, low-slung posture with its head turned slightly upward and outward, displaying stylized facial features, pointed ears, and prominent eyes. The musculature is smoothly articulated along the chest, shoulders, and hindquarters, flowing down into a curled tail. The sculpture is mounted securely onto a stepped, dark oval wooden or composite base, providing an elevated presentation. The physical dimensions cannot be precisely determined from the photo alone, but the proportions suggest a medium-sized decorative mantel or tabletop object. There are no clearly visible maker marks, signatures, or stamps discernible in the provided image. The overall style and aesthetic characteristics are broadly consistent with twentieth-century decorative animalier bronzes, often associated with Art Deco or mid-century interior ornaments. The item shows light surface wear and minor variations in the patina consistent with normal aging, but no structural damage or major repairs are immediately apparent. The identification rests purely on visual form and subject matter, as the piece remains unauthenticated and lacks any visible documentary provenance.

AI Appraisal Report

Based on what I can see in the provided image, this sculpture depicts a sleek, stalking panther in a dark-toned metallic medium, mounted on a stepped oval base. The piece displays a mottled brown and green patina and stylistic traits consistent with twentieth-century animalier bronzes. However, I can't verify from a photo whether the material is solid cast bronze, a plated metal, or a composite resin, nor can I see any maker marks or signatures to establish authorship. My appraisal value range of $400-800 assumes the piece is a vintage mid-century cast bronze decorative object. The market for mid-century animalier sculptures generally shows steady demand among collectors of decorative arts, though values fluctuate based on exact material composition, weight, and artistic finesse. If physical inspection reveals this piece to be a modern reproduction, replica, or a mass-market decorative copy rather than a vintage bronze, the value would likely decrease to the $100-250 range. To confirm authenticity, material composition, and precise age, would need physical inspection to confirm, along with potential metallurgical testing and research into comparable manufacturer catalogs.
